@@ -131,29 +134,46 @@ function configure_containerd() {
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d]
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ata]
|
||||
runtime_type = "io.containerd.kata.v2"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ata.options]
|
||||
ConfigPath = "/opt/kata/share/defaults/kata-containers/configuration.toml"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-fc]
|
||||
runtime_type = "io.containerd.kata-fc.v2"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-fc.options]
|
||||
ConfigPath = "/opt/kata/share/defaults/kata-containers/configuration-fc.toml"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-qemu]
|
||||
runtime_type = "io.containerd.kata-qemu.v2"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-qemu.options]
|
||||
ConfigPath = "/opt/kata/share/defaults/kata-containers/configuration-qemu.toml"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-nemu]
|
||||
runtime_type = "io.containerd.kata-nemu.v2"
|
||||
[plugins.cri.containerd.runtimes.kata-nemu.options]
|
||||
ConfigPath = "/opt/kata/share/defaults/kata-containers/configuration-nemu.toml"
|
||||
EOT
